  2. MARY OF SCOTLAND YARD IS KILLED IN GOOD CAUSE

    "Knock twice and ask for Mary," is a frequent instruction to students at Scotland Yard's Detective School. "Mary" is a life-sized dummy, who is "murdered" at least half-a-dozen times a week—and each time by a different method. Training with "Mary" possibly helped in the solution recently of an almost ...
